Integrating Volunteer Software with Your CRM and Other Tools

Managing volunteers across multiple systems can quickly become messy. Spreadsheets, emails, and separate databases often lead to duplicate entries and missed opportunities for engagement. Integrating your volunteer software with your CRM and other tools creates one connected system where data flows automatically, “helping your team save time and gain clear insights. 

Whether you use HubSpot, Salesforce, or another platform, seamless integration strengthens relationships, improves reporting, and keeps your volunteer program running efficiently.

In this article, we’ll explore the importance of integration and how you can do it with ease. Ready? Let’s dive in! 

Why Integration Matters for Volunteer Management

Integration is the backbone of efficient volunteer management, connecting every part of your system so information flows where it’s needed. When your tools work together, you can eliminate silos, improve accuracy, and unlock insights that drive deeper engagement and measurable impact.

Streamlining data between systems

When your volunteer software and CRM share data automatically, updates in one system appear everywhere else. This eliminates duplicate records, keeps contact information current, and ensures your team always works from the same reliable source of truth.

Reducing manual entry and human error

Manual data entry wastes time and increases the risk of mistakes. Integration automates these processes so your team can focus on people instead of spreadsheets.

Automation helps by:

  • Syncing volunteer and donor records instantly across platforms
  • Updating contact and participation details in real time
  • Eliminating duplicate entries and inconsistent data
  • Reducing staff workload while improving accuracy

Improving volunteer and donor engagement

When your CRM and volunteer software share data, every message and interaction can be more personal and timely. You’ll know which volunteers also donate, which donors volunteer, and how often they engage.

The added insight allows you to customize outreach, celebrate milestones, and strengthen long-term relationships that keep people connected to your mission.

Gaining a full picture of organizational impact

Integrated systems give you a clear view of how volunteers, donors, and programs all work together to advance your mission. Instead of juggling separate reports, you can see real-time participation, retention, and fundraising data in one place. This makes it easier to measure progress and communicate results to stakeholders.

With all your data connected, you can uncover patterns that drive smarter decisions. You’ll spot which volunteer efforts lead to stronger donor relationships, identify high-impact programs, and allocate resources where they make the biggest difference.

Common Tools to Connect with Volunteer Management Software

Volunteer management software works best when it connects seamlessly with the tools your organization already uses. Integrations create a unified system that keeps every department aligned, from marketing to fundraising to program delivery. Below are some of the most common platforms that enhance efficiency and collaboration when paired with your volunteer software.

CRM systems (HubSpot, Salesforce, Blackbaud)

CRMs like HubSpot, Salesforce, and Blackbaud serve as the central hub for all your relationship data. When your volunteer management software connects directly to these systems, every activity, such as sign-ups, hours logged, or event attendance, helps flow into a single profile.

Email and marketing automation platforms

Email and marketing automation tools help you reach volunteers at the right time with the right message. Connecting platforms like Mailchimp, Constant Contact, or HubSpot Marketing Hub allows your volunteer data to drive communication automatically.

You can segment audiences by interests or activity level, trigger welcome sequences after sign-ups, and send reminders before events. Integration ensures every message feels personal and timely without requiring your team to manage lists manually.

Event registration and scheduling tools

Integrating event registration and scheduling tools lets volunteers sign up, confirm attendance, and receive updates without extra coordination from staff. Systems like SignUpGenius, Eventbrite, or built-in scheduling features sync automatically with your volunteer software, keeping rosters accurate and calendars up to date in real time.

Fundraising and donation tracking software

Connecting your volunteer software with fundraising tools like GoFundMe Pro, Bloomerang, or DonorPerfect helps you see how volunteer activity relates to giving behavior. This link reveals which programs inspire donations, making it easier to nurture relationships and highlight the impact of volunteer contributions.

Communication tools (Slack, Teams, SMS platforms)

Smooth communication keeps volunteers engaged and informed. Integrating platforms like Slack, Microsoft Teams, or SMS tools allows quick updates, group coordination, and reminders to reach people where they already are.

Real-time messaging helps staff share event details, respond to questions, and keep everyone aligned without relying on long email chains. The result is faster collaboration and a stronger sense of connection across your volunteer community.

Benefits of a Unified Volunteer Data Ecosystem

When your volunteer software and CRM work together, data becomes more than just numbers—it becomes insight. A unified system helps your team see the bigger picture, connect patterns across programs, and strengthen relationships with volunteers and donors alike. The following benefits show how integrated tools can elevate every part of your volunteer strategy.

Centralized reporting and analytics

Centralized reporting turns scattered data into clear, actionable insights. With all your volunteer and donor information in one place, you can track performance, identify trends, and make informed decisions quickly.

An integrated dashboard helps you:

  • Combine volunteer, fundraising, and event data for complete visibility
  • Measure participation, retention, and impact across programs
  • Create shareable reports for leadership, funders, and stakeholders
  • Reduce time spent compiling and verifying data manually

Personalized volunteer communication

When all your data connects, every message can feel tailored to the individual. Volunteers receive updates and invitations that reflect their interests, past involvement, and preferred ways to engage. This level of unique personalization builds trust and helps people feel recognized for their contributions. It also strengthens long-term relationships by showing volunteers that your organization values their time and impact.

Improved team coordination and transparency

Integrated systems make it easier for staff, coordinators, and volunteers to stay aligned. Everyone can access the same up-to-date information, reducing confusion and unnecessary back-and-forth communication.

Connected tools help teams:

  • Share real-time updates on events and sign-ups
  • Track volunteer hours and assignments across departments
  • See who is handling specific tasks or communications
  • Avoid scheduling conflicts and duplicated efforts

Transparency builds trust within your organization and ensures volunteers always know what’s expected and where they’re needed most.

Better retention and recognition programs

Retention starts with recognition, and integrated data makes both effortless. When your systems talk to each other, every logged hour, milestone, or donation becomes an opportunity to celebrate.

You can automatically send thank-you notes, highlight top contributors in newsletters, or surprise long-time volunteers with personalized messages. These small, data-driven gestures turn casual participants into loyal advocates who feel seen and appreciated—because they are.

How to Prepare for Integration

Preparing for integration sets the stage for a smooth, successful rollout. Before connecting systems, your organization needs to understand its current tools, clean up data, and set clear objectives. The following steps help ensure your integrations deliver meaningful results instead of added complexity.

Assess current tools and data workflows

Start by mapping out every tool your team uses to manage volunteers, donors, and events. Identify where data overlaps, where it’s siloed, and which processes cause the most frustration. This step helps you spot opportunities to streamline workflows and choose integrations that actually solve problems rather than add new ones.

Clean and organize existing data

Integration works best when your data is accurate and consistent. Review your contact lists, volunteer records, and event histories to remove duplicates and correct errors. Standardize naming conventions, formats, and tags so imported data aligns smoothly across systems and avoids confusion later.

Define integration goals and KPIs

Set clear goals for what success looks like before connecting any systems. Decide what outcomes matter most to your organization, then choose measurable KPIs to track progress and impact over time.

Example goals and KPIs might include:

  • Reducing manual data entry by a set percentage
  • Increasing volunteer retention within a specific time frame
  • Improving reporting accuracy and data completeness
  • Shortening the time between sign-ups and follow-up communication
    Tracking the number of synced records or successful data transfers

Involve IT and program management teams

Successful integration is a team effort. Bring your IT staff and program managers into the process early so technical needs and daily workflows are both considered.

IT can handle system compatibility, security, and data mapping, while program managers ensure the integration supports real-world volunteer operations. 

Steps to Successfully Integrate Your Volunteer Software

Once your organization is prepared, it’s time to bring the integration to life. A thoughtful, step-by-step approach helps avoid data loss, downtime, and confusion for your team. The following steps outline how to connect your volunteer software smoothly and set it up for lasting success.

Choose compatible software with open APIs

Choose software that supports open APIs so your systems can exchange data securely and efficiently. Open APIs make it easier to connect platforms without custom coding or workarounds. Look for tools designed with integration in mind, allowing your volunteer software and CRM to communicate smoothly from the start.

Map data fields between platforms

Mapping data fields ensures information moves correctly between systems. Before syncing, review how each platform labels contacts, activities, and custom fields so nothing is misplaced or duplicated.

Key data to map includes:

  • Volunteer and donor names
  • Contact details and communication preferences
  • Event participation records
  • Hours logged and roles held
  • Notes, tags, or segmentation fields

Once these fields are aligned, data will sync consistently across systems, creating a single, accurate record of every interaction.

Test synchronization and troubleshoot errors

Before rolling out your integration organization-wide, run small-scale tests to confirm data is syncing correctly. Start with a few records and track how information moves between systems.

If issues appear, such as missing fields or duplicated entries, then be sure to review your mapping setup and integration settings. Troubleshooting early prevents larger problems later and ensures your team can trust the data once the system is live.

Train staff on new workflows

After the integration is live, take time to train your staff on how the new system works. Show them where to find synced data, how to update records, and when automations will run.

Hands-on practice helps staff understand not just the technology, but how it improves their daily workflow. Clear documentation and follow-up sessions keep everyone confident and consistent in using the connected system.

Monitor and optimize post-launch performance

Once the integration is running, monitor its performance regularly to make sure data continues syncing accurately and efficiently. Track metrics like sync speed, error rates, and user feedback to identify what’s working and what needs adjustment.

Use these insights to refine automations, clean up outdated records, and improve system settings over time. Treat integration as an evolving process that strengthens with ongoing attention and optimization.

Explore Golden’s Seamless Integrations for CRMs and Beyond

Golden was built to help nonprofits see the full picture of their impact. Our flexible API connects seamlessly with CRMs, fundraising tools, and marketing platforms, giving teams a single source of truth for volunteer and donor data. Whether you need to sync with Salesforce, Blackbaud, Virtuous, and more. Golden’s integrations are secure, customizable, and built to scale as your organization grows.Experience a smarter way to manage relationships, streamline operations, and keep your mission moving forward. Schedule a demo and see Golden in action today.


What You Should Do Next

1:1 consultation aimed at transforming your volunteer program

Learn how to transform supporters into donors

Help us spread our message